Interparietal bones in Nigerian skulls.

S K Saxena1, D S Chowdhary, S P Jain.   

Abstract

The study was conducted on 40 adult Nigerian skulls which were examined for the presence of interparietal and pre-interparietal bones. Only one interparietal bone was found (2.5% of the present series) while a single pre-interparietal bone was found in four skulls (10%) and multiple pre-interparietal bones in one skull (2.5%).
